Answer:
[tex]10^{-4} = 0.0001[/tex]
Step-by-step explanation:
Negative exponents make the base a reciprocal:
[tex]x^{-1} = \frac{1}{x}\\x^2 = \frac{1}{x^2}\\[/tex]
Therefore, we can rewrite [tex]10^{-4}[/tex] as:
[tex]10^{-4} = \frac{1}{10^4} = \frac{1}{10000} = 0.0001[/tex]
